It's understood informal discussions have been held between the Football Association of Wales and UEFA over a potential name change.

The FAW is considering the idea of adopting the moniker "Cymru" - the Welsh name for Wales - on the international stage after this year's World Cup.

The change would end the country's status as being the last, alphabetically, of the 55 UEFA members
